Season and Care of Nectarine and Fennel

Season and care of Nectarine and Fennel is important to know. While considering everything about Nectarine and Fennel Care, growing season is an essential factor. Nectarine season is Spring, Summer and Fall and Fennel season is Spring, Summer and Fall. The type of soil for Nectarine is Loam, Sand and for Fennel is Loam, Sand while the PH of soil for Nectarine is Acidic, Neutral and for Fennel is Neutral, Alkaline.

Nectarine and Fennel Physical Information

Nectarine and Fennel physical information is very important for comparison. Nectarine height is 150.00 cm and width 150.00 cm whereas Fennel height is 60.00 cm and width 30.00 cm. The color specification of Nectarine and Fennel are as follows:

  • Nectarine flower color: White, Red and Light Pink

  • Nectarine leaf color: Green

  • Fennel flower color: Yellow

  • Fennel leaf color: Light Green

Care of Nectarine and Fennel

Care of Nectarine and Fennel include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Nectarine pruning is done Prune in winter,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ves and Fennel pruning is done Cut or pinch the stems, Remove dead branches, Remove dead leaves, Remove dead or diseased plant parts and Remove deadheads. In summer Nectarine need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er Fennel need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
